In an experiment similar to the one you just completed analyzing your salt's composition, student teams in another course prepared magnesium sulfate crystals. Students analyzed their salts then prepared the class data table shown below. From this data, calculate the average percent composition (by mass) of water in the hydrated salt.
Starting
Constant
team
Mass of sample (g)
Mass after heating (g)
ace
3.274
1.583
bean
2.189
1.08
geek
4.349
2.103
not
4.338
2.118
winky
2.072
1.022
a.
51.2%
b.
Not enough information is given to determine the % composition of water in the salt.
c.
48.74%
d.
105%
e.
95.3%

Explanation / Answer
Calculation of average mass% water in MgSO4 sample
MgSO4.xH2O
mass% = (average mass water/average mass sample) x 100
from the data given above,
average mass sample = 3.2444 g
average mass water = sum(mass sample - final mass)/5 = 1.6632 g
therefore,
mass% water = (1.6632/3.2444) x 100 = 51.264%
Answer,
a. 51.2%
